Frequently Asked Questions about Downtown Dallas
How much are Studio apartments in Downtown Dallas?
There are currently 71 Studio Apartments in Downtown Dallas with rent ranges from $920 to $3,800 with an average price of $1,864.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Downtown Dallas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Downtown Dallas ranges from $905 to $12,400 with an average monthly rent of $2,374.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Downtown Dallas c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Downtown Dallas range from $1,192 to $21,150.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,002.
How expensive are Downtown Dallas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 62 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Downtown Dallas on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,577 to $24,375 - averaging $8,737 for the location.
